Livemocha is described as 'The world’s most popular language learning site. Learn online with our award winning course and practice with native speakers. Best way to learn a new language' and is a language learning tool in the education & reference category. There are more than 50 alternatives to Livemocha, not only websites but also apps for a variety of platforms, including iPhone, iPad, Android and Android Tablet apps. The best Livemocha alternative is Anki, which is both free and Open Source. Other great sites and apps similar to Livemocha are Duolingo, Memrise, Busuu and Rosetta Stone.

    Anki is a program which makes remembering things easy. Because it is a lot more efficient than traditional study methods, you can either greatly decrease your time spent studying, or greatly increase the amount you learn.

    Duolingo offers a gamified platform to learn over 30 languages for free. Engage in reading, writing, speaking, and listening practice with intelligent chatbots. Join 300 million users and track progress with rewards. Optional Duolingo Plus removes ads and adds features.

    Provides courses for 12 languages created by native experts, covering grammar, vocabulary, reading, writing, speaking, and listening, with offline mode, placement tests, personalized study plans, official certification, and a global learning community.

    Language-learning platform using spaced repetition with images, text, sound, and videos to teach foreign languages without translation. Supports writing exercises and grammar lessons. It offers immediate scoring and customizable feedback, ideal for personalized progression.

    Connects language learners with teachers worldwide for personalized one-on-one sessions. Offers lessons in over a hundred languages, fostering human connections and disrupting traditional education methods. Accessible online with flexible scheduling.

    Immerse in language learning with authentic audio, podcasts, books, and web-imported material, review vocabulary with a spaced repetition system, track progress with usage statistics and avatar growth, and sync your data across devices for online and offline study.
